如何在CodeBlocks中设置和管理不同的编译器以及进行跨平台C++项目开发?
时间: 2024-12-03 08:42:18 浏览: 7
CodeBlocks作为一款开源且免费的集成开发环境,以其轻便和跨平台特性受到开发者的青睐。为了在CodeBlocks中设置和管理不同的编译器以及进行高效的跨平台C++项目开发,建议参考《CodeBlocks中文版:开源、免费的C/C++ IDE》这份资源。
参考资源链接:[CodeBlocks中文版:开源、免费的C/C++ IDE](https://wenku.csdn.net/doc/9nm3iu0jaa?spm=1055.2569.3001.10343)
首先,在CodeBlocks中设置不同的编译器,你需要进行编译器管理。打开CodeBlocks,进入“Settings”菜单,选择“Compiler”,然后点击“Add”按钮来添加一个新的编译器。CodeBlocks支持GCC、Clang等多种编译器。选择相应的编译器后,根据提示完成安装路径的配置,并命名你的编译器配置。之后,你可以在新建项目时选择相应的编译器,或者在已有的项目设置中更改编译器配置。
接下来,针对跨平台C++项目开发,CodeBlocks能够让你在同一套源代码基础上,适应不同平台的特定要求。你可以在项目设置中配置不同的编译选项和链接选项,以满足不同操作系统的运行时环境。同时,CodeBlocks支持构建脚本的编写和自定义构建步骤,这使得开发者可以创建适用于不同平台的构建规则。
在项目管理方面,CodeBlocks通过直观的用户界面帮助开发者组织和管理项目。使用Project视图和Symbols视图,用户可以轻松地添加、删除项目文件,管理头文件和库依赖。同时,CodeBlocks支持版本控制系统,如Git,可以实现项目的版本控制。
总之,了解和掌握CodeBlocks中的编译器设置和项目管理功能,对于进行高效的跨平台C++项目开发至关重要。深入学习《CodeBlocks中文版:开源、免费的C/C++ IDE》将帮助你更好地利用CodeBlocks的各种特性,提升开发效率和项目质量。
参考资源链接:[CodeBlocks中文版:开源、免费的C/C++ IDE](https://wenku.csdn.net/doc/9nm3iu0jaa?spm=1055.2569.3001.10343)
阅读全文